Before tagging a release of Meridia Sync, verify the conflict-resolution settings carefully. SYNC_CONFLICT_POLICY accepts "newest-wins" or "manual-queue"; releases shipped with "manual-queue" require the review dashboard to be enabled, or conflicted events silently pile up. Also confirm SYNC_WINDOW_DAYS matches what QA tested, since mismatches reintroduce the duplicate-event bug from last quarter. Finally, the sync worker authenticates to the upstream calendar bridge, and its credential must be set on the following line.

vault entry, yahif-yajep: COURIER_KEY29=b802bdf8034096b65a51c6ba5abe2

## Tuning render performance

If Quillpress starts chewing CPU during peak traffic, the template cache is almost always the culprit. Bump the cache size before touching worker counts — partial eviction thrash looks exactly like slow templates. Restart the render pool after any change so the values actually take. Here are the knobs and their current defaults.

tuning constants:
QUOTAS = {
    "druwyn": 5,
    "holix": 5,
    "zorath": 5,
    "holwyn": 10,
}

### Runbook: Load testing the Cartwheel checkout flow

Heads up if you're on call during a scheduled load test: the Cartwheel checkout flow gets hammered by the synthetic harness every other Thursday, and it can look a lot like a real traffic spike. Before you page anyone, check whether the harness is active — its requests carry a synthetic-traffic header, so the dashboards split them out. If you need to tune or pause the harness mid-run, it reads its settings from the shared config service. The current run uses these values.

settings of fafog-haduf:
ZORIX_PIN=4648
ZORIX_METRICS_HOST=metrics.zorix.paliqsys.corp
ZORIX_LOG_LEVEL=info
ZORIX_TENANT=druix

TURN-208: Gatevale turnstile counters at the Merrow Field pilot double-count when a rotation reverses mid-cycle. Attendance totals drift roughly 2% high per event. The debounce window fix is implemented, reviewed by Ilsa, and soak-tested across two simulated match days without drift. Ready for your cut; the candidate build is identified below.

trace token, tagag-tafog: htk6_5ed18c